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
181803764 817708222 31 078491844 6770514
43908 850
43908 850
1638 892252864 1469
All about undefined
Interested in learning more?
43908 850
1638 892252864 1469
See more
92595784380 89523720
8084 17768297613 9743 92113
See more
68664458141 0705537
75 183 942837353 811038023
See more